  Collins Aerospace is seeking a Senior Electrical Design Engineer to support the CNS (Communications, Navigation, and Surveillance) group. Collins Aerospace designs, integrates, and certifies commercial avionics products for the Air Transport and Business and Regional aircraft markets.

  This role will be part of the team developing the next generation of avionics product, working with a small group of hardware Engineers. Applicant must have demonstrated knowledge of the principles and techniques commonly used in electrical development. This position may encompass both new product development and legacy product sustaining support activities.

  Applicant must be self-motivated, self-disciplined, with good communications skills, and a demonstrated ability to work within a multifunctional, multidiscipline team. The candidate will be required to demonstrate flexibility and an ability to coordinate with multiple teams, organizations, suppliers, and customers to achieve a common goal.

  Job Responsibilities:

  Project Engineering experience leading multi domain teams

  Identify and mitigate project risks. Ability to analyze data and determine appropriate actions to correct program problems before they impact the overall program.

  Records and documents delays, changes in scope, and any other incidents that impact the scope of work or schedule to ensure smooth project operations.

  Performs critical path analysis and prepares and implements work-around plans to ensure the successful completion of projects.

  Develop and analyze electrical design requirements.

  Design and prototype circuits.

  Analyze circuit performance using circuit simulation tools like Spice, ADS etc.

  Design, debug, and test digital, analog and RF circuits.

  Develop schematics, oversee PCB layouts, and support design drawings development.

  Participate in the build, debug, and test of digital and mixed signal circuits.

  Conduct circuit tests using lab test equipment (O ’scope, Spectrum Analyzer, Network Analyzer, Logic Analyzer etc.)

  Develop verification test plans, procedures, and test reports to ensure the developed product meets the specified requirements.

  Collaborate with Mechanical Engineering, Industrial Design Engineering, Manufacturing & Test Engineering and Safety & Reliability Engineering to ensure robust designs and appropriate testability.

  Support product certification activities (FAA TSO and Customers specific).

  Qualifications/Experience Needed:

  Typically requires a degree in Science, Technology, Engineering or Mathematics (STEM) unless prohibited by local laws/regulations and minimum 5 years prior relevant experience or an Advanced Degree in a related field and minimum 3 years of experience or in absence of a degree, 9 years of relevant experience.

  Must be authorized to work in the U.S. without sponsorship now or in the future. RTX will not offer sponsorship for this position.

  Experience in design, debug, and test of analog, digital and RF design.

  Experience with common circuit simulation platforms such as Spice, ADS etc.

  Familiarity with software defined radio design.

  Preferred Qualifications:

  Experience with Project Management on complex and higher budget projects.

  Experience with model-based development.

  2 years in circuit level development engineering or holding a master's degree with Digital/RF/Microwave focus.

  Familiarity with signal processing system simulation & analysis tools (e.g., MATLAB, Simulink).

  Experience with major types of lab test equipment (Power supplies, O ’scopes, Spectrum Analyzers, Network Analyzers, Logic Analyzers, etc.).

  Experience with Digital and RF design.

  Experience with DO-160 environmental/EMI qualification, and TSO approval processes.

  Experience with RTCA DO-254 standards for Design Assurance Guidance for Airborne Electronic Hardware.

  Familiarity with avionics design and certifications standards for commercial air transport applications.

  Familiarity with DME and NAV products design.

  Experience working with embedded processors and FPGA’s.

  Experience with Jira/JAMA/SVN/DOORS.

  Experience with Mentor Graphics DX Designer Schematic capture and layout tools.
